Good sitting starts at the feet. The footboard gives a client in the Rifton Activity Chair a firm surface to load through, so the pelvis stays back in the seat and the trunk has something to work against as the client sits up.
The knee angle is adjustable, so you can set it for tight hamstrings, a fixed knee position or a client who needs their feet further forward to feel stable. The height moves with the client as they grow, and the adjustment is tool free, so a teacher aide or a parent can change it between sessions without waiting for a review.
